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: RMPR4P22

Package: Prosthetics

Routine: RMPR4P22


Information

RMPR4P22 ;PHX/HNC/RVD-CONT PURCHASE CARD ;3/1/1996

Source Information

Source file <RMPR4P22.m>

Call Graph

Call Graph

Call Graph Total: 3

Package Total Call Graph
Prosthetics 3 $$DEC^RMPR4LI  HDR^RMPR4P21  $$STA^RMPRUTIL  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
Prosthetics 1 RMPR4P21  

Entry Points

Name Comments DBIA/ICR reference
START
ZWE
EXT ;CHECKING FOR EXTENDED DESCRIPTION
WRI ;CONTINUATION OF 10-2421
CONT
ADD
ADD1
CON ;CONTINUATION OF 2421

External References

Name Field # of Occurrence
$$DEC^RMPR4LI CON+15
HDR^RMPR4P21 CONT+2
$$STA^RMPRUTIL CON+26

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!!,?9,"***SEE ATTACHED CONTINUATION SHEET FOR ITEM DESCRIPTION(S)***",!
  • Line Location: RMPR4P22+3
Function Call: WRITE
  • Prompt: !!,?9,"***SEE ATTACHED CONTINUATION SHEET FOR ITEM DESCRIPTION(S)***",!
  • Line Location: RMPR4P22+5
Function Call: WRITE
  • Prompt: !!,?9,"***SEE ATTACHED CONTINUATION SHEET FOR ITEM DESCRIPTION(S)***",!
  • Line Location: RMPR4P22+13
Function Call: WRITE
  • Prompt: !
  • Line Location: RMPR4P22+16
Function Call: WRITE
  • Prompt: !,"#"_RO_"."
  • Line Location: START+0
Function Call: WRITE
  • Prompt: ?4,$P(R664(1,RO,0),U,2)
  • Line Location: START+2
Function Call: WRITE
  • Prompt: ?50,$J($P(R664(1,RO,0),U,4),6)
  • Line Location: START+3
Function Call: WRITE
  • Prompt: ?61,$P(^PRCD(420.5,+RMPRUT,0),U,1),?65,$J($FN(RMPRI,"P",2),6)
  • Condition for execution: $D(^PRCD(420.5,+RMPRUT,0))
  • Line Location: START+3
Function Call: WRITE
  • Prompt: ?72,$J($FN(RMPRTOT,"P",2),8)
  • Line Location: ZWE+0
Function Call: WRITE
  • Prompt: !
  • Line Location: EXT+9
Function Call: WRITE
  • Prompt: !
  • Line Location: EXT+12
Function Call: WRITE
  • Prompt: !
  • Line Location: EXT+15
Function Call: WRITE
  • Prompt: !
  • Line Location: EXT+18
Function Call: WRITE
  • Prompt: !,@RMPR90
  • Line Location: WRI+1
Function Call: WRITE
  • Prompt: !!,?9,"***CONTINUATION OF PURCHASE CARD ITEMS ON NEXT PAGE***"
  • Line Location: CONT+1
Function Call: WRITE
  • Prompt: @IOF,!,"CONTINUATION OF PURCHASE CARD ",?27,"ORDER NUMBER: ",$P($G(^RMPR(664,RMPRA,4)),U,5),?71,"PAGE ",RMPRPAGE
  • Line Location: CONT+2
Function Call: WRITE
  • Prompt: !,RMPRB,!,"16. Contract Number: "
  • Line Location: CON+1
Function Call: WRITE
  • Prompt: $P(R664(1,RO("C"),0),U,14)
  • Condition for execution: RO("C")
  • Line Location: CON+1
Function Call: WRITE
  • Prompt: ?61,"Subtotal: ",$J($FN(RMPRAMT,"P",2),8)
  • Line Location: CON+1
Function Call: WRITE
  • Prompt: !," ACCT.#: ",RMPRVACN
  • Line Location: CON+2
Function Call: WRITE
  • Prompt: ?28,"Discount $"
  • Line Location: CON+3
Function Call: WRITE
  • Prompt: $J($FN(RMPRAMT2,"P",2),7)
  • Line Location: CON+3
Function Call: WRITE
  • Prompt: ?45,"Shipping: ",$J($FN(RMSHI,"P",2),5)
  • Line Location: CON+4
Function Call: WRITE
  • Prompt: ?62,"Total",?69,"$",$J($FN(RMPRAMTN,"P",2),9)
  • Line Location: CON+5
Function Call: WRITE
  • Prompt: !,RMPRB,!,"17. Signature of"
  • Line Location: CON+6
Function Call: WRITE
  • Prompt: ?28,"18. DATE",?39,"19. Signature and Title of",?70,"20. Date"
  • Line Location: CON+7
Function Call: WRITE
  • Prompt: !,?5,"Requesting Official",?39,"Contracting/Accountable Officer"
  • Line Location: CON+8
Function Call: WRITE
  • Prompt: !!,?5,RDUZ,?39,RMPR("SIG")
  • Line Location: CON+9
Function Call: WRITE
  • Prompt: !,RMPRB,!?25,"Order and Receipt Action",!,RMPRB
  • Line Location: CON+10
Function Call: WRITE
  • Prompt: !,"21. Order Number",?18,"22. Exp Date",?37,"23. Date Item Received",?62,"24. Date Delivered"
  • Line Location: CON+11
Function Call: WRITE
  • Prompt: !,?3,"encrypted"
  • Line Location: CON+18
Function Call: WRITE
  • Prompt: !,RMPRB
  • Line Location: CON+21
Function Call: WRITE
  • Prompt: !,"25. The articles or services listed herein have been received, or rendered",!,"ordered in the quantity and quality specified originally or as shown by"
  • Line Location: CON+22
Function Call: WRITE
  • Prompt: !,"authenticated changes, except as noted.",!!?40,"Signature of Veteran or VA Official",!,RMPRB
  • Line Location: CON+23
Function Call: WRITE
  • Prompt: !,?$X+6,"Acct. Symbol ",$$STA^RMPRUTIL,"-"_$P($G(^RMPR(664,RMPRA,4)),U,5)
  • Line Location: CON+26
Function Call: WRITE
  • Prompt: !,RMPRB,!,?52,"ADP Form 10-2421PC APR 1991"
  • Line Location: CON+27

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^PRCD(420.5 - [#420.5] START+3
^RMPR(664 - [#664] CONT+2, CON+12, CON+15, CON+26
^XUSEC("RMPR FCP MANAGER" CON+12

Label References

Name Line Occurrences
ADD RMPR4P22+14, RMPR4P22+15
ADD1 ADD+2
CON CONT
CONT RMPR4P22+15, EXT+9, EXT+12, EXT+15, EXT+18, EXT+29, EXT+30
EXT ZWE
START RMPR4P22+15

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DUZ CON+12
>> I RMPR4P22+2*, RMPR4P22+3, RMPR4P22+5, RMPR4P22+13
II RMPR4P22+12*, RMPR4P22+13!
IOF CONT+2
>> J RMPR4P22+4*
>> J1 RMPR4P22+2, RMPR4P22+3*, RMPR4P22+4, RMPR4P22+5*, RMPR4P22+6, RMPR4P22+13*
>> J2 RMPR4P22+2*, RMPR4P22+4*, RMPR4P22+5, RMPR4P22+13
LNCT EXT+2~, EXT+3*, EXT+9, EXT+10*, EXT+12, EXT+13*, EXT+15, EXT+16*, EXT+18, EXT+20!
>> R664(0 ADD+1
>> R664(1 RMPR4P22+2, RMPR4P22+4, RMPR4P22+8, RMPR4P22+9, RMPR4P22+10, RMPR4P22+11, RMPR4P22+15, START+1, START+2, START+3
ZWEEXT+4, EXT+5, EXT+6, EXT+7, EXT+22, EXT+28, EXT+31, ADD+2, ADD1
CON+1
>> R664(2 ADD+3
>> RC ADD+2*, ADD1
>> RDUZ CON+9
>> RMPR("SIG" CON+9
>> RMPR90 EXT+27*, EXT+28*, EXT+31, WRI+1
>> RMPRA CONT+2, CON+12, CON+15, CON+26
>> RMPRAMT ADD*, ADD+3, ADD1*, CON+1
>> RMPRAMT1 ADD*, ADD1*
>> RMPRAMT2 ADD*, ADD+3*, CON+3
>> RMPRAMTN ADD*, ADD+3*, CON+5
>> RMPRB CON+1, CON+6, CON+10, CON+21, CON+23, CON+27
>> RMPRCH EXT+22*, EXT+23
RMPRCNT RMPR4P22+7*, RMPR4P22+12*, RMPR4P22+13, EXT+2~, EXT+3*, EXT+20!
>> RMPRDISC ADD+3*
>> RMPRI START+1*, START+3, ZWEADD+2*, ADD1
>> RMPRMOR RMPR4P22+15, RMPR4P22+16, EXT+9, EXT+12, EXT+15, EXT+18, EXT+29, EXT+30, CONTCONT+1
CONT+2*
>> RMPRMOR1 CON+27*
>> RMPRPAGE CONT+2*
RMPRPRCD CON+14~, CON+15*, CON+17
RMPRSSM EXT+2~, EXT+20!
RMPRSSM( RMPR4P22+12
RMPRSSM(1 RMPR4P22+8*, EXT+4*, EXT+8, EXT+10
RMPRSSM(2 RMPR4P22+9*, EXT+5*, EXT+17, EXT+19
RMPRSSM(3 RMPR4P22+10*, EXT+6*, EXT+14, EXT+16
RMPRSSM(4 RMPR4P22+11*, EXT+7*, EXT+11, EXT+13
>> RMPRTOT ZWE*
>> RMPRUT START+3*
RMPRVACN CON+2!
>> RMSHI ADD+1*, ADD+3, CON+4
>> RO RMPR4P22+2*, RMPR4P22+4, RMPR4P22+8, RMPR4P22+9, RMPR4P22+10, RMPR4P22+11, RMPR4P22+15*, STARTSTART+1, START+2
START+3, ZWEEXT+4, EXT+5, EXT+6, EXT+7, EXT+22, EXT+28, EXT+31
>> RO("C" CON+1*
>> RP RMPR4P22+4*
U RMPR4P22+8, RMPR4P22+9, RMPR4P22+10, RMPR4P22+11, START+1, START+2, START+3, ZWEEXT+4, EXT+5
EXT+6, EXT+7, CONT+2, ADD+1, ADD+2, ADD+3, ADD1CON+1, CON+12, CON+15
CON+26
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All